Description\n

American Traveler is hiring a travel RN for a Med/Surg Telemetry position at a Magnet-designated acute care hospital in Illinois, requiring at least 1 year of med/surg or telemetry experience on a weekend night block schedule.

Details\n
    \n
  • Med/Surg Telemetry unit in a 97-bed Magnet-designated acute care hospital
  • \n
  • Weekend night block schedule: Friday, Saturday, and Sunday, 12-hour night shifts (1845–0715)
  • \n
  • Patient ratios of 1:4–5
  • \n
  • Charting via Epic (experience required)
  • \n
  • Floating may be required between two campuses (Belleville and Shiloh) as well as within the facility
  • \n
  • No on-call requirements
  • \n
Requirements\n
    \n
  • Active IL RN license required; pending IL license is not accepted for this position
  • \n
  • Current certifications required: BLS, ACLS, and NIH Stroke Scale (NIHSS)
  • \n
  • Minimum 1 year of med/surg, cardiac, or telemetry nursing experience required
  • \n
  • Epic EMR experience required
  • \n
Additional Information\n
    \n
  • First-time travelers are welcome to apply
  • \n
  • Candidates residing within 75 miles of the facility are subject to a local pay rate
  • \n
  • RTO is limited to no more than 7 days per 13-week contract; no RTO is permitted during the first week of orientation
  • \n
  • Navy scrubs required
  • \n
  • Free parking on-site
  • \n
  • Travelers may remain at BJC facilities for up to 18 months, after which a 3-month break in service is required
  • \n
  • Former permanent employees of any BJC facility must wait 1 year before returning as a traveler
  • \n
